Crime Statistics Comparison: Hatton vs Des moines
- In Des moines, the total crime rate is higher at 38.39 incidents per 1000 compared to 14.14 in Hatton.
- More property crimes occur in Des moines at 32.04 incidents per 1000 compared to 7.07 in Hatton.
- Violent crime rates are higher in Hatton at 7.07 incidents per 1000 compared to 6.35 in Des moines.
- Lower unemployment is observed in Des moines at 3.5% versus 3.2% in Hatton.
- The poverty rate in Des moines is higher at 14% compared to 9% in Hatton.
